AuntieStella · 09/01/2020 17:13

Aftershoks

Bone conducting headphones are by far the safest (as you can still hear what's happening around you). Good battery life and sound quality too

Bone-conducting ones are the only sort approved by England Athletics for road races (though in practice you'll probably see all sorts)
